The future of homework: how homework practices are evolving in modern education

As educational practices evolve, so does the role of homework.

Online learning tools, interactive platforms, and digital resources allow for more dynamic and personalized homework experiences.

The future of homework may also include more individualized assignments, tailored to a student’s specific strengths and weaknesses.

Collaborative homework may become more common in the future, as group projects foster teamwork and communication skills.

Ultimately, the future of homework is focused on creating more meaningful and engaging assignments.
